URC: Round 14 Predictions

We’re back to URC action this weekend, and the jostle for the top 8 continues. Just 1 point separates 7th from 11th, and every team is trying to move up the standings, as am I in Superbru.

Here are my United Rugby Championship predictions for Round 14 this weekend.



Most look fairly straightforward to pick, but I’ll be alert to team news for Leinster in particular - they won’t be at full-strength against the Lions, and the hosts could well turn them over.

Bulls v Munster is the other highlight, and whilst the Bulls should win, I’m backing Munster to collect a losing bonus point, which could be important in the final reckoning.
